This remove support for coercing non-ReferenceCounted types that are neither default-constructible nor move-assignable, but it turns out none of the classes we really need it for matches that.
It further cuts down on the amount of code that is being generated to support coercion in cases where it makes absolutely no sense.

This adds missing definitions from the standard library header ` stdint.h` to the interrogate header.
I also changed the `typedef` to the C++11 style `using`.
